#dda024 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dda024 is composed of 86.7% red, 62.7%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.6% magenta, 83.7%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 40.2 degrees, a saturation of 73.1% and a lightness of 50.4%. #dda024 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ff48 with #bb4100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#dda024 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dda024 has RGB values of R:221, G:160,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.84,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14524452.
